Step-by-step explanation:

Given the coordinate (x, y), if reflected over the y-axis, the resulting coordinate will be (-x, y):

Given the coordinates of the triangle expressed as:

A(1. 5), B(2, 3), and C(5, 4)

When these coordinates are reflected over the y-axis, the results will be:

A'(-1, 5), B'(-2, 3), and C'(-5, 4)

Note that the x coordinates were negated while the y-coordinates remains unchanged
